FF120: Shaping Skills

Course Details

Are you interested in shaping?

Do you even know what ‘shaping’ is?

Do you want to know what the 5 key skills to shape, that will allow you to shape any sports behaviour or life skill?

Do you want to understand how to use shaping to work through frustration and help your dog develop the ability to ‘think in arousal’?

If so, join Kamal Fernandez, long time FDSA faculty member for an in depth look at shaping and help you understand it, or if you currently shape behaviour, get feedback to take your skills to the next level!

This course will cover:

  • Key skills to shape for any dog sport
  • Understanding errorless learning
  • Clean and clear training processes
  • Working through frustration via shaping
  • Improve mechanical skills and understand the 5 w’s of reinforcement

Teaching Approach

This course will comprise of weekly video lectures detailing the skills to shape, feedback on each skill and understanding how to progress, and how to implement these skills into other behaviours.

Syllabus

View Full Syllabus

Shaping Skills Syllabus!

Week 1:

- Intro to marker words

  • - Using props
  • - Shaping differently… when to use and not use your clicker!
  • - Shaping basics, starting off shaping and what to shape shape first (On something), release cue.

Week 2:

  • - In something
  • - Teaching duration
  • - Green light/red light
  • - Tweezer fingers/Rapid feeding

Week 3:

  • - Around something
  • - Shaping motion, or speed

Week 4:

-Targeting!

  • - Head, shoulders, paws and toes!
  • - Using targets..
  • - Exit plans for targets!
  • - Creating distance!

Week 5:

  • - Pick up something
  • - Building duration

Week 6:

  • - Cues, proofing, spicing up your behaviours!
  • - How to add verbal cues, chaining basics and variable schedules of reinforcement!

Prerequisites & Supplies

View all Prerequisites & Supplies

For this course you will need the following items: - A box large enough for your dog to be able to sit in - Platform/cushion large enough for your dog to stand on - Target stick/wooden spoon - Plastic pipe large enough for your dog to hold - Perch. Examples of this can be an upturned dog bowl, plant pot base or any other suitable item. - Large cone with stable base that cannot be knocked over by your dog
